One significant aspect of IP law is patent protection. Patents grant inventors the right to exclude others from making, using, or selling their inventions for a specified period. For technology firms in Illinois, this can mean the difference between thriving as a market leader and losing ground to competitors. For instance, a software firm that develops a novel algorithm can patent it, securing exclusive rights that can lead to significant financial benefits and enhanced market positioning.
Copyright law is another essential component of IP protection, especially for technology firms that rely heavily on software and digital content. In Illinois, companies need to understand that copyright protects the expression of ideas, not the ideas themselves. This distinction is vital for tech firms creating original software, games, or digital media, as it allows them to safeguard their creative works from unauthorized reproduction and distribution.
Trademarks, too, form a critical part of the IP landscape for Illinois technology firms. A trademark can protect logos, brand names, and symbols, allowing consumers to identify a company's products or services easily. By establishing strong trademarks, tech firms can differentiate themselves in a competitive market, fostering customer loyalty and brand recognition.
